How would you describe/define a system?

I would describe a system as a series of components working together to achieve


a certain goal. A database which can be accessed and edited to complete certain
tasks. Resources and processes combined to achieve a purpose.

How would you define information?

I would define information as data which has undergone a series of information


processes.

What are the information processes?

COASPTD

C- Collecting

O- Organising
A- Analysing

S- Storing/Retrieving

P- Processing

T- Transmit/Receive

D- Displaying

Define the relationship between data, information and knowledge.

Data, information and knowledge all interrelate. Information starts off as raw
data which then undergoes the information processes to become information,
knowledge is gained from information.

The difference between a personal information system and a group information


system:

The number of participants is the difference between a personal information


system and a group information system. A personal information system would
generally only have one participant whereas a group information system would
have a number of participants.

List some of the social and ethical issues we have discussed:

- OH & S – Ergonomics

- Privacy

- Copyright

- Piracy

- Plagiarism

- Illegal downloading

- Accuracy of data

- Security
Collecting:

The process of accumulating data to be entered into an information system


and undergo information processes.

The information process that gathers data from the environment.

It includes:

- Knowing what data is required

- From where it will come

- How it will be gathered.
